Holland America Line’s 2028 Grand Voyages on course to deliver new experiences

Holland America Line has unveiled the itineraries for its two 2028 Grand Voyages, offering travellers an opportunity to choose between a 129-day circumnavigation of the globe aboard the 2028 Grand World Voyage or a 90-day deep dive into Australia, New Zealand and the South Pacific on the Grand Australia & New Zealand Voyage.
Holland America Line President Beth Bodensteiner was onboard the line’s 2026 Grand World Voyage when she announced the news.
Bodensteiner said that: “What makes our Grand Voyage itineraries special is the opportunity to experience destinations more fully while visiting rare Mariners’ Collection ports exclusive to these cruises.”
The cruise line’s President continued: “In direct response to our guests, the 2028 Grand Voyages are anchored by truly unforgettable moments, from exploring Antarctica and crossing the globe on the Grand World Voyage to sailing past Null Island, where the Prime Meridian and the Equator meet at zero, and calling at legendary destinations like Easter Island and Bora Bora.”
Both 2028 Grand Voyages are anchored by ambitious, bucket-list experiences. On the Grand World Voyage, that means a full Antarctic Experience and an immersive sweep through South America, including scenic cruising through the Chilean Fjords, Glacier Alley and the Beagle Channel.
The voyage also contains a call at Easter Island and a sail-past of Null Island, where the Prime Meridian and the Equator intersect at 0°N, 0°E. On the Grand Australia & New Zealand Voyage, it means rare access to the remote, seldom-visited shores of Western Australia that appear on few cruise itineraries — all without stepping on an international flight.
Both voyages include a call at Bora Bora, making 2028 the first-time Holland America Line has sent both Grand Voyages to the crown jewel of the South Pacific in a single season.

The 2028 Grand Voyages sail aboard Volendam and Zaandam, ships renowned for their ability to reach ports that larger vessels cannot — intimate enough to dock in remote harbors, spacious enough to feel like home for several months.
The 2028 Grand World Voyage departs Jan. 4 roundtrip from Fort Lauderdale, Florida.
The 2028 Grand Australia & New Zealand Voyage departs Jan. 30 roundtrip from San Diego, California.
